In Episode 154 of our Survival Game Development series, we continue the implementation of player sleeping mechanics in Unreal Engine 5. This is the second part of the dive into how sleep will affect the player character, including rest, health recovery, and time progression.

We cover step-by-step how the sleep system is integrated into the survival gameplay loop, ensuring that your character can rest realistically and that in-game time advances appropriately.
